Transaction ed2b7657251b873a78d7181f3ec59e39d7b4c321c226b2f2346c3866187549c6

17 Input
1 Outputs
  • ed2b7657251b873a78d7181f3ec59e39d7b4c321c226b2f2346c3866187549c6:0
  • value  3147757
    address  3FRmRbPiYACCwhvAg3oYiduT4rxTPuqfop